Whats Wollongong famous for?

Wollongong is noted for its heavy industry, its port activity and the quality of its physical setting, occupying a narrow coastal plain between an almost continuous chain of surf beaches and the cliffline of the rainforest-covered Illawarra escarpment.

Does Wollongong have airport?

Shellharbour Airport, formerly Illawarra Regional Airport, also referred as Albion Park Aerodrome or Wollongong Airport, (IATA: WOL, ICAO: YSHL) is an airport located in Albion Park Rail, Shellharbour City, New South Wales, Australia.

Is Wollongong a town or a city?

Wollongong (/ˈwʊlənɡɒŋ/ WUUL-ən-gong), informally referred to as The Gong, is a city located in the Illawarra region of New South Wales, Australia. Wollongong lies on the narrow coastal strip between the Illawarra Escarpment and the Pacific Ocean, 68 kilometres (42 miles) south of central Sydney.
